The Polar Plunge is the Chill of a Lifetime! Join us for the Polar Plunge for Special Olympics.
Raise a minimum of $75 (or $50 for Polar Bears under 18) and take a chilly dip into a pool that will be set up in the Texas Roadhouse parking lot. Prizes for the top individual fundraiser and for the top fundraising teams in corporate/civic, school and law enforcement divisions. There are also prizes for the best individual and group costumes.

Can’t plunge, but still want to support Special Olympics? No problem. Register as a Virtual Plunger. You get a Plunge shirt and are eligible for all other fundraising awards.

Either way, you’ll be Freezin’ for a Reason!

2023 Lexington Polar Plunge Awards

Top Fundraiser — Lizzie Faulconer, Danny’s Grill; $6,635 raised
2nd Leading Fundraiser — Carson Faulconer, Danny’s Grill ; $6,380 raised
3rd Leading Fundraiser — Kevin Curren; $4,201 raised

Top Special Olympics Athlete Fundraiser Leigh Ann Fallis; $1.968 raised

Top Fundraising Corporate/Civic Division Team — Danny’s Grill; $15,919 raised
Top Fundraising School Division Team — License to Chill (UK); $1,765 raised
Top Fundraising Law Enforcement Division Team — Madison County Sheriff; $3,771

Best Group Costume Danny’s Grill – Assorted Food and Condiments
Best Individual Costume David Lautzenheiser – UK Klingon
